Edexcel GCSE Art & Design – ESA 2026
Theme: FOUND

Student Project & Planning Pack
This structured GCSE Art & Design resource has been fully updated to support the Edexcel Externally Set Assignment (ESA) 2026 theme: FOUND.
It guides students step-by-step through the entire ESA process, from initial idea generation to final exam preparation, using clear language, strong visual prompts and GCSE-appropriate expectations. The resource encourages independent thinking while maintaining clear links to the assessment objectives.

What’s included:

  • A clear introduction to the FOUND theme, explained in accessible, student-friendly language
  • Four structured pathways:
  • People
  • Natural World
  • Human-Made
  • Environment

A stimulating ideas table designed to support brainstorming, mind maps and mood boards, covering:

  • Concepts
  • Emotions
  • Types of found subjects
  • Natural and human-made sources
  • Spaces and visual elements
  • Week-by-week guidance covering:
  • Mind maps and mood boards
  • Artist and photographer research
  • Observational work
  • Experimentation and refinement
  • Design development
  • Exam preparation and evaluation
  • Clear minimum page expectations to help students manage workload and meet GCSE standards
  • Separate guidance for Fine Art and Photography students

Why this resource works:

  • Fully aligned with Edexcel GCSE Art & Design AO1–AO4
  • Encourages original responses rather than copying artist styles
  • Helps students understand how to move from ideas to outcomes
  • Ideal for structured teaching, cover lessons or independent learning
  • Suitable for a wide range of abilities and pathways

Suitable for:

  • Edexcel GCSE Art & Design
  • Years 11
  • Fine Art and Photography
  • Classroom teaching or digital portfolios

Format:

  • PDF & PPT Versions included
  • Ready to print or use digitally
  • Works as a complete ESA guide or as individual lesson resources
